Drew Charteris, a self-centered, arrogant theatre critic refuses to let his 17 year-old daughter marry the successful young playwright she loves. Clara, a friend of the family schemes with the young girl to outwit the pompous father with the help of the girl's fiancee in this delightful farce, adapted from a classic Moliere comedy.
Published in Comedy Tonite!
